DESILVA GATES QUARRY <br /> START-UP AND YEAR 2027 AVERAGE DAILY TRUCK TRIP GENERA I[ON <br /> Average Daily <br /> Average Yearly Average Yearly Average Daily Truck Loads Average Daily 2- <br /> 'W Production Tons Production Das Production Tons 25 Tons/Truck Way Truck Trips <br /> AtStart-U : <br /> 500,000 250 2,000 80 160 <br /> Year 2027• <br /> 800,000 250 3,200 128 256 <br /> Net Increase in Yearly <br /> Production: <br /> r <br /> 300,000 250 1,200 48 96 <br /> On a yearly basis, there is generally one or more peak production months in which more aggregate is <br /> produced then would be the monthly average. As this could significantly increase the number of trucks, <br /> and as how this could be a condition that could last for a month or more, a peak adjustment factor was <br /> developed to reflect this condition. The peak daily truck generation was developed based on estimated <br /> peak month production information provided by the applicant and other individual quarry operators. The <br /> review of this information resulted in an average peak daily production estimate that is approximately 40- <br /> percent higher than the average daily production. To account for the estimated peak production, the <br /> im average daily truck loads shown in Table 7 were adjusted up by a factor of 1.4. <br /> The resulting estimated peak daily truck generation from the proposed DeSilva Gates quarry both at start- <br /> up and by the year 2027 is shown in Table 8. On a peak production day, Table 8 shows that the proposed <br /> project will generate 224 truck trips per day at start-up increasing to 358 truck trips per day by the year <br /> 2027 resulting in an increase of 134 additional peak daily truck trips. <br /> TABLE 8 <br /> DESILVA GATES QUARRY <br /> START-UP AND YEAR 2027 PEAK DAILY TRUCK TRIP GENERATION <br /> Average Daily Peak Daily <br /> Average Yearly Production Truck Loads Adjustment Peak Daily Peak Daily 2-Way <br /> Tons (25 Tons/Truck) Factor Truck Loads Truck Trips <br /> At Start-Up: <br /> 500,000 80 1.4 112 224 <br /> Year 2027: <br /> 800,000 128 1.4 179 358 <br /> Net Increase in Yearly <br /> '�. <br /> Production: <br /> 300,000 48 1.4 67 134 <br /> r. <br /> Table 9 illustrates the estimated start-up and year 2027 distribution of all project trucks to the State <br /> Highway System via the SR-132/Bird Road intersection. As shown in the table, approximately 25% of <br /> the trucks generated by the proposed project are estimated to have origins/destinations to the northwest <br /> via I-580, 50% are estimated to have origins/destinations to the north via I-5, 10% are estimated to have <br /> origins/destinations to the south via 1-5, and 15% are estimated to have origins/destinations to the east via <br /> SR-132. <br /> L <br /> 2nd Draft DeSilva Gates Quany Trak&Circulation Analysis 15 October 2005 <br /> Jones&Stokes (R905T7S002 125-4000-02) <br /> I <br />
